Hannah Corr workshops


Hannah Corr is hosting the following workshops at the Cathays Methodist Hall in Cardiff:

Saturday 18 August - North African Dance
Experience the vibrant dances of Morocco, Algeria & Egypt. With emphasis on group dancing, strong rhythms and energetic movement this is the perfect opportunity go wild and let your hair down!

2 till 5pm, £18

Saturday 15 September - Tarab
Tarab is the state of surrender and ecstasy that you feel when listening to Arabic music. Learn to find the Tarab in your own dance, to interpret Arabic music and allow yourself to be transported by the beautiful tones of the oud, violin, ney and intoxicating rhythms of the drum.
2 till 5pm, £18


Saturday 27 October - Goddess Dance Workshop: Morrigan
Morrigan is the dark Celtic Goddess of battle, passion and death who takes the form of beautiful woman or hag. We are all beautiful and ugly but only by knowing both sides can we truly be ourselves. As Samhain/Halloween symbolises the descent into darkness, so we too will turn inward. Don't be afraid, meet your unknown self! Please bring 2 black/dark veils or sarongs.
11am till 2pm, £18

Middle Eastern Music Workshop - October 13


Maren Lueg is leading a Middle Eastern Music Workshop for instrumentalists at the Victoria Rooms in Bristol on Saturday 13 October.

The workshop covers the muisc of Egypt, Syria, Lebanon and the Gulf area in this hands-on workshop. Bring your instruments and learn Middle Eastern melodies and scales, either by ear or from sheet music (provided) and learn about the basic principles of ornamentation and melodic improvisation used in Arabic music.

Anyone without an instrument can learn to play traditional rhythms on a selection of Arabic percussion instruments such as the Egyptian Darbuka and Duff (provided).

As the day progresses all students will join together for a fantastic combined performance of music from this exotic and fascinating culture.

The course costs £22.50 and runs from 10am-4pm - tea and coffee will be available mid morning but you'll need to make your own arrangements for lunch from 1-2pm.

Ozgen Workshops and Disco - August 4


Ozgen is coming back to Bristol to hold some workshops and attend a disco on Saturday 4 August.

Workshop 1 from 12 till 2.30 is aimed at beginners to intermediate level. It'll be an introduction to Turkish bellydance, including a harem routine and gypsy moves.

Workshop 2 from 3-5pm is for intermediate, advanced and teachers. This includes a drum solo, Kurdish moves, folk dance, and cabaret style Turkish bellydance.

The workshops take place at the Southville Centre, Beauley Road, Southville. Price is £22, £20 early bird booked before July 14, or £17 to teachers wanting to take part in Workshop 2.

The Everything Egyptian bazaar will be open before the 2 workshops.

In the evening, you're invited to join Ozgen at a Bellydance Disco at Statis Bar, Baldwin Street, Bristol. No performances as such, just everyone dancing together - wear your jangly hip scarf or sparkly dress and come on down. Admission is £5 - teachers who bring students admitted free.
